private static string FormatSize(long bytes)
{
if (bytes <= 0) return "0 B";
string[] units = { "B", "KB", "MB", "GB", "TB" };
double size = bytes;
int u = 0;
while (size >= 1024 && u < units.Length - 1)
{
size /= 1024;
u++;
}
return u == 0 ? $"{(long)size} {units[u]}" : $"{size:0.##} {units[u]}";
}
